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7517820 33973420700 323216198 5839
2386 42613
2386 42613
246419 57031868 76091480 718
All about undefined
Interested in learning more?
2386 42613
246419 57031868 76091480 718
See more
9545 201951 2928971140
92299431622 858348 9711 220
See more
19 42157450
156 14378965987 0932
See more